Veterans Description for Public
Harrow War Memorial Obelisk - Veterans Description for Public
The Harrow War Memorial Obelisk, located on Blair Street outside the RSL Hall, commemorates the First and Second World Wars, Korea, Vietnam and Malaya. On each side of the obelisk the names of those who served a listed. Nearby white memorial seats were donated by the Harrow Country Women's Association in memory of Private Eric Walker who died of illness in the Second World War, and R.A.F. Squadron 612, F/O John Joseph Minogue, who died near the English Channel, 23rd May 1944.
